Handover note — Crumbwheel order cutoffs.

Welcome aboard. The bakery cutoff rule in Crumbwheel closes same-day orders at 14:00 local to each storefront, not UTC — this has bitten us twice. Holiday overrides live in the calendar service and take precedence silently, so always check there first when a cutoff looks wrong. To unlock the calendar service's admin console after a restart, enter the recovery passphrase below.

vault phrase of bagap-bahaf = silion-pelox-sorox-casdor-quenwyn-fraax-eliox-praael-kelion-quenvan-kasox-rusael-norius-belvan

Handover note — Records Team. The signed score sheets from the Veldmark Regional Chess Final are boxed, sorted by round, and cross-checked against the arbiter's ledger by Mira Olsten. Two sheets from round four carry corrections initialled by the chief arbiter; these are flagged with green tabs. The box is sealed and waiting in the archive anteroom. The courier hand-over instruction is as follows:

dispatch memo: the fenael gormir courier leaves the kelath ledger at gate 7035 under passcode 975267

### Step 4: Load test the checkout flow

Before publishing your plugin to the Cartwright marketplace, run the bundled Stampede harness against the staging checkout flow. Set CHECKOUT_TARGET to the staging host and RAMP_USERS to 500. Stampede signs each synthetic order so staging can distinguish test traffic from real purchases, and that signing requires a secret in your .env, added on the line below.

sealed setting: LEDGER_TOKEN29=f64de0290ccd124b8c2beec8321e2

## Changelog — SproutCycle v2.4.0

Heads up: we changed the default watering window. Previously SproutCycle assumed a 6am–8am slot for all zones, which caused midday overwatering complaints from the Fernmoor pilot greenhouses. The scheduler now derives windows from each zone's humidity profile, and the fallback interval dropped from 24h to 12h. Existing deployments keep their old settings unless you run the reset script, so no panic needed for the release cut. For reference, the new shipped defaults are below.

deployment values, kajep-kageg:
[praix]
host = praix.paliqcorp.corp
user = praix_svc
database = praix_prod